
Quarter-Pound Chili Cheeseburger
The burger that made the stand at Beverly and Rampart famous. A beef patty and a slice of cheese buried under Tommy’s thick house chili, with onions, pickles, a slab of tomato and mustard. It is sloppy in the best way and needs a pile of napkins. The chili is the star; the burger is almost its delivery system.
The story
Tom Koulax started ladling chili over burgers and hot dogs in 1946, and the chili burger became the whole identity of the stand. Its success spawned dozens of copycats across Los Angeles with near-identical names, and the family chose not to chase most of them in court, fighting only for the words “Original” and “World Famous”.
What’s inside
- Original Tommy’s chili
- 100% beef patty
- cheese
- onions
- pickles
- tomato
- mustard
- bun
